AMUSEMENTS.
QUEEN'S THEATRE. To-day's new list of pictures at the Queen's Theatre is headed by a tJirccreel star drama (Barker) called '• The Little Home in the West.'"' It deals with society life and the scene is afterwards transferred to the front trenches. The supporting pictures are " Home Breaking Hounds.'- a Keystone farce-comedy, ''Midwinter in Swedish Norland r ' (scenic), "Through Edith's Looking-glass ; ' (comedy.!, and tho latest ''Topical Budget."
GRAND THEATRE. In. the change of programme at the Grand Theatre to-day the principal attraction will be the Charles Chaplin comedy, "His Regeneration.'' in which the well-known comedian is li.aluieci with (J. M. Anderson, the well-known " Broncho Billy.;' J -John bull's Sketch Book, No, o."' also diows Charles Chaplin as u Highlander. /• The Master Key " .serial will tw continued, tiie seventh instalment, being shown. This serial has caught on in popular favour, and each instalment appears to increase m interest. Other i>;etures ■will |ie " Bloomer and Sherlock Holmes" (comedy >, "A Bunch ut Matches " (cxmiedy). " Tho Eclair Jouiu:il"' (topicab.
